Archive Enforcement Breach / 归档执行破口
Archive Enforcement Breach is the visible event that fires when an enforceable archive order is resisted, voided, delayed too long, publicly countered without enough legal support, or physically obstructed by a claimant who should have complied.
The event exists to prevent archive enforcement from becoming invisible bookkeeping. When execution fails or mutates, route assets, followers, public legitimacy, and future rites must change.

Partial success rule
A breach may coexist with relief. For example, a public counter-enforcement can raise public legitimacy while increasing inspection heat; a formal service can protect an artist refusal while turning the sponsor hostile.
The event must preserve both facts. It cannot flatten the result into pure success or pure failure unless every surface clearly moved that way.
